Special Needs Capital Grant for Rent
The Special Needs Capital Grant (SNCG) mechanism aims to provide housing for rent to meet the housing needs for people with particular needs. Projects funded by this grant mechanism must contribute to a local community care strategy and be supported by the relevant statutory bodies.
Applicants may be private developers, including non registered housing associations and trusts, or voluntary organisations. The grant must not exceed 40 per cent of the total costs though some exceptions, in circumstances, can be made to increase above this level the percentage available for voluntary organisations.
The Special Needs Capital Grant is administered through a local network of Scottish Government offices (takes to an external website).
